Ishant out of 13 shortlisted for fourth Test

SYDNEY: India reversed their choice Wednesday to rule out top spinner Ravichandran Ashwin from the fourth Test in opposition to Australia, while tempo spearhead Ishant Sharma used to be mysteriously lacking from their 13-man squad.

Indian officials had earlier advised reporters Ashwin had now not recovered from an belly strain that has saved him out of the remaining two Tests, and skipper Virat Kohli had lamented the offspinner's absence, pronouncing he used to be "very disappointed" to miss the final match of the collection.

But barely an hour later, his identify used to be at the squad listing tweeted through the BCCI, India's governing frame.

"A decision on R Ashwin's availability will be taken on the morning of the Test," it mentioned ahead of what is expected to be a turning track at the Sydney Cricket Ground.

In a surprise, first-team common Ishant Sharma used to be now not included with the explanations unknown. Fast bowler Umesh Yadav used to be named as his alternative.

Wrist-spinner Kuldeep Yadav used to be also at the squad listing and may play along finger-spinner Ravindra Jadeja if Ashwin is not fit and India go for two sluggish bowlers.

Middle-order batsman Rohit Sharma, who hit a gritty 63 in the first innings at Melbourne, is not to be had after jetting back to Mumbai to be together with his wife who not too long ago gave delivery.

KL Rahul, who used to be axed for the remaining Melbourne Test, is back in contention and may open the innings with Mayank Agarwal, with Hanuma Vihari losing back off to No.6 as quilt for Rohit Sharma.

The Ashwin u-turn used to be now not defined, although there used to be speculation that Jadeja may additionally now not be fully fit.

Kohli had earlier mentioned of Ashwin: "The physio and the trainer have spoken to him in terms of what's required in order to get over that injury."

"He is very disappointed with the fact that he has not been able to recover in time, but the things have been laid out to him (over) what needs to be done to get back to full fitness."

"Honestly, you can't predict an injury, when it happens you just manage and he is doing what he can to get over that injury."

India pass into the final Test 2-1 up and with a first collection win in Australia in their points of interest.

But Kohli insisted making historical past used to be now not their number one purpose.


"The reason why we want to win this Test is because we understand as cricketers how difficult it is to come here and play," he mentioned.


"It's is not only the team you are playing against but the whole nation as they get behind their team so well."


"Purely just to take that challenge on, we want to win here. It's got nothing to do with proving that we have done something that hasn't been done in the past."


India squad: Mayank Agarwal, KL Rahul, Hanuma Vihari, Cheteshwar Pujara, Virat Kohli (capt), Ajinkya Rahane, Rishabh Pant, Ravindra Jadeja, Kuldeep Yadav, Ravichandran Ashwin, Mohammed Shami, Jasprit Bumrah, Umesh Yadav.
